commit | c941579e952193195d56f812574ce442d9576834 | [log] [tgz] |
---|---|---|
author | Danil Chapovalov <danilchap@webrtc.org> | Mon Oct 09 13:28:57 2023 |
committer | WebRTC LUCI CQ <webrtc-scoped@luci-project-accounts.iam.gserviceaccount.com> | Wed Oct 11 10:34:17 2023 |
tree | 0509ad0dee17e2d36199ea84a76150864d7c341a | |
parent | c4f3919fdd2cca9f39d6fcd52066ad8ac8aff9fe [diff] |
Move field trial check WebRTC-DisableRtxRateLimiter Checking in sending classes avoids using global field trial string in favor of the injected one. In addition to that RateLimiter looks wrong layer for check that field trial: checking inside RateLimiter class might be surprising if it is used for limiting something else than RTX bitrate. evaluating field trial for each retransmitting packet might be expensive Bug: webrtc:15184, webrtc:10335 Change-Id: I87bae3522bbd9692629d4f9b6caa119be03f2bd6 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/322720 Commit-Queue: Danil Chapovalov <danilchap@webrtc.org> Reviewed-by: Ying Wang <yinwa@webrtc.org> Reviewed-by: Mirko Bonadei <mbonadei@webrtc.org> Reviewed-by: Jakob Ivarsson‎ <jakobi@webrtc.org> Cr-Commit-Position: refs/heads/main@{#40908}
WebRTC is a free, open software project that provides browsers and mobile applications with Real-Time Communications (RTC) capabilities via simple APIs. The WebRTC components have been optimized to best serve this purpose.
Our mission: To enable rich, high-quality RTC applications to be developed for the browser, mobile platforms, and IoT devices, and allow them all to communicate via a common set of protocols.
The WebRTC initiative is a project supported by Google, Mozilla and Opera, amongst others.
See here for instructions on how to get started developing with the native code.
Authoritative list of directories that contain the native API header files.